## Sweeper Overview

The Tidewell orphaned-resource sweeper runs nightly and flags volumes, snapshots, and network endpoints that have no owning deployment record. It never deletes anything on its first pass; flagged items enter a seven-day quarantine, during which owners can reclaim them via the Reclaim tool. As a contractor, do not manually delete quarantined items, even if they look abandoned. The full quarantine lifecycle and override procedure are described on the internal reference page.

dashboard of kawef-fajeg = https://artifactory.orvexstack.local/ticket/job/secrets/spaces/projects/board/board/8f9ae898ff6436b96db23ab4

## Formula sandbox tuning

User-supplied formulas in Gridmoor execute inside a restricted interpreter with hard ceilings on time, memory, and call depth. Reviewers should confirm any change to these ceilings is justified in the PR description, since raising them widens the abuse surface. Defaults were chosen from production traces. The current limits are as follows.

limits module of tafog-fawip:
WEIGHTS = {
    "julix": 57,
    "lamys": 992,
    "kasvan": 209,
    "quenok": 750,
    "alddor": 259,
    "oliath": 1009,
    "wenix": 815,
}

### Runbook: BounceBroom — Account Recovery

If the BounceBroom email bounce processor loses access to its service account, do not create a new one. First, pause the intake queue so bounces buffer safely. Then open the recovery console and select the BounceBroom principal. Verification requires approval from the on-call lead. Once approved, the console prompts for the stored recovery credentials; enter the passphrase that appears directly below this paragraph.

recovery phrase for fahof-kahap: holion-gormir-jorix-istix-briwyn-sorael

- [ ] Key ceremony step 7 (Fernwick Ledger): verify bulk-edit lock in the admin table before signing. Select all pending key rows, apply the "ceremony freeze" bulk edit, and confirm no row remains editable. Witness initials required in the margin. Once the freeze is confirmed, unlock the custodian drawer using the passphrase that follows.

recovery phrase for bawep-kawef: oliath-casdor